Jordan Harbinger, host of The Jordan Harbinger Show, shares insights from over 1,000 interviews with icons like Kobe and Mark Cuban. He discusses the lessons learned from the successes and failures of the rich and famous. The conversation dives into the emotional turmoil behind fame, the pursuit of validation, and the irony of success, revealing how personal connections can define fulfillment. They also reflect on jealousy, self-reflection, and the importance of focusing on growth, while celebrating their friendship and podcasting milestones.
